    BUX (https://getbux.com) is a licensed European neobroker / version of Robinhood (without the scammy history) with recent $80 million investment round and 600k funded users in their equities platform that is integrating their crypto platform (https://bux-c.com) with their equity platform in December. Source: over 2 years ago
